Welcome to Rosemont, IL!
Located directly between Chicago O'Hare International Airport and the city of Chicago, Rosemont is a small village. Still quite young, it was only incorporated in 1956, though it had been a suburb of Chicago for years before. Due to its favorable location, much of the village is occupied by large hotels, conference centers and office buildings, including nearly every major hotel chain operating in the United States. Thus, Rosemont has become a top meeting, convention, tradeshow and entertainment hub, hosting an average 50,000 visitors a day. In this sense, it is a quintessential edge city, as the village's daytime population and employment base exceeds the number of actual residents. In order to accommodate this startling demographic, there are over 5,000 hotel rooms located throughout Rosemont, along with numerous event and meeting venues.The Donald E. Stephen Convention Center is the 11th largest meeting, convention and trade show facility in the nation. The 19,000 seat Allstate Arena hosts more than 150 events a year, including concerts, sporting and circus events and a massive flea market. In 2007, the Rosemont 18 joined the Rosemont Theatre, in providing the region with a great variety of entertainment.
